Theoretically, zinc can exert a number of indirect antioxidant functions. Researchers at our laboratory have found evidence to support this concept by studying mild zinc deficiency in rats. This state produces low resistance to chemically induced liver oxidant injury, and it produces high vulnerability of lipoproteins to oxidation.
